Confused?! So, was I when I wrote the topic. I am trying to integrate Frets On Fire into GameEx as an emulator and make the songs for it like the "Roms". However, in Frets On Fire, each song has numerous associated files, and they are rolled into a single folder for the song.

Now, back to my question, is there any such rom filter that will make it display the names of all the folders and when selected, start the emulator and I can use [RomFolder] as the parameter for my command line? You know something like a Rom Filter of [Folders]?

Well you could with something like this

Frets.exe "[rompath]/[rom]/[romfile]"

This would of course mean that your ROM name would have to be the same as the subfolder name.

You would also need a Map file. (At least Ive seen this in other configs.)

i made map files for all my FoF song listing. since gameex doesnt have the feature to make multiple game lists per emulator yet. On FoF's fourms theres a cool song manager app that will export your song names and folder names to .txt. Here's a example map file for GH3 songs

yeah it works great, only issue is anytime you add new songs to your setup you have to redo the map files or they wont show up. you have to setup each map file as its own emulator for this to work
